当前位置: 首页 > news >正文

Seraphine:英雄联盟玩家的自动化智能助手

Seraphine:英雄联盟玩家的自动化智能助手

【免费下载链接】Seraphine英雄联盟战绩查询工具项目地址: https://gitcode.com/gh_mirrors/se/Seraphine

Seraphine是一款基于英雄联盟官方LCU API开发的智能战绩查询工具,专为追求竞技优势的玩家设计。通过自动化数据采集和智能分析,该工具能够在游戏对局前后提供关键的队友对手情报、BP决策支持以及客户端功能增强,帮助玩家在信息层面建立竞争优势。


🔍 核心关键词与功能定位

核心关键词:英雄联盟战绩查询、智能BP系统
相关长尾关键词:LCU API自动化工具、队友对手数据分析、大乱斗英雄Buff显示、客户端无限加载修复、段位图标自定义


🚀 项目价值主张与核心优势

在英雄联盟的竞技环境中,信息获取效率直接影响游戏决策质量。Seraphine通过官方API实现无缝集成,提供以下核心价值:

数据驱动的决策支持:自动采集并分析队友对手的历史战绩、英雄熟练度、胜率数据,将零散信息转化为可操作的战术建议。

流程自动化优化:替代繁琐的手动查询操作,在BP阶段自动获取队友数据,游戏开始后自动分析对手信息,让玩家专注于游戏本身。

安全合规的技术实现:完全基于Riot Games官方LCU API开发,不修改游戏文件或内存,确保账号安全的同时提供丰富功能。


🛠️ 核心功能深度解析

实时战绩查询系统

Seraphine的实时战绩查询功能是其最核心的差异化特性。工具通过LCU WebSocket连接实时监控游戏状态,在不同阶段自动触发相应的数据采集:

BP阶段自动查询:进入英雄选择界面后,系统自动获取同队召唤师的近期战绩、常用英雄、胜率数据,为团队阵容搭配提供参考依据。

对局开始后对手分析:游戏加载完成后,立即查询敌方队伍成员的历史数据,包括英雄池深度、位置偏好、胜率趋势等信息。

多模式数据适配:支持排位赛、匹配模式、大乱斗等多种游戏类型,根据不同模式调整数据展示维度和分析重点。


Seraphine在竞技场模式中的胜利数据分析界面

智能BP辅助决策系统

自动BP流程优化是Seraphine的另一大亮点,通过配置化的策略设置实现BP阶段的高效操作:

功能模块传统手动操作Seraphine自动化优势
对局接受手动点击接受按钮可配置延迟自动接受(0-11秒)
英雄禁用凭记忆选择禁用英雄基于版本数据和对手英雄池智能推荐
英雄选择手动搜索并选择快速锁定预设英雄或推荐选择
交换处理手动确认交换请求自动接受队友英雄交换提议

位置特定策略配置:玩家可以为不同游戏位置(上单、打野、中单、ADC、辅助)设置独立的BP优先级和禁用策略,系统会根据当前分配的位置自动应用相应配置。

OPGG数据集成与英雄分析

Seraphine深度整合OPGG数据源,为玩家提供专业的英雄强度参考:

大乱斗专属优化:在ARAM模式下自动显示每个英雄的伤害加成/减免百分比,帮助玩家快速评估英雄在当前模式下的强度。

版本强势英雄识别:基于OPGG实时胜率数据,自动标记当前版本的Tier 1和Tier 2英雄,为BP决策提供数据支持。

出装符文一键应用:在英雄选择界面直接查看OPGG推荐出装和符文配置,支持一键应用到游戏客户端。


Seraphine展示的段位数据分析界面

客户端功能增强模块

客户端稳定性修复:针对英雄联盟客户端常见的无限加载、界面卡顿等问题,提供一键修复功能,包括自动重连机制和热重启选项。

个性化定制功能:支持修改个人主页背景、自定义在线状态、调整段位显示样式、一键卸下勋章和头像框等客户端美化操作。

性能优化监控:实时监控客户端资源占用情况,提供优化建议和清理方案,确保游戏运行流畅。


📦 安装与配置指南

环境要求与准备工作

系统要求:Windows 10/11 64位操作系统
游戏要求:英雄联盟客户端最新版本
Python环境:Python 3.8或更高版本(源码运行需要)

快速安装方式

对于大多数用户,推荐使用预编译的可执行文件:

  1. 从项目仓库下载最新的Seraphine.7z压缩包
  2. 解压到任意文件夹(建议非系统盘)
  3. 双击运行Seraphine.exe
  4. 按照首次运行向导完成基础配置

开发者源码运行

如需自定义功能或参与开发,可通过以下步骤从源码运行:

git clone https://gitcode.com/gh_mirrors/se/Seraphine cd Seraphine conda create -n seraphine python=3.8 conda activate seraphine pip install -r requirements.txt python main.py

基础配置流程

首次启动Seraphine后,按顺序完成以下配置:

  1. 游戏路径设置:工具会自动检测英雄联盟安装路径,如未找到可手动指定
  2. 客户端连接:确保英雄联盟客户端正在运行,Seraphine将自动建立连接
  3. 核心功能启用:在设置界面选择需要的功能模块,建议初次使用全选
  4. 个性化参数调整:根据个人游戏习惯调整各项参数,如自动接受延迟、BP策略偏好等

⚙️ 高级配置与深度使用

配置文件详解

Seraphine的主要配置集中在app/common/config.py文件中,用户可根据需求调整以下关键参数:

基础功能开关

enableAutoAcceptMatching = True # 自动接受对局匹配 enableAutoReconnect = False # 自动重连功能 autoShowOpgg = True # 自动显示OPGG数据 showTierInGameInfo = True # 游戏中显示段位信息

视觉与界面设置

winCardColor = '#2839b01b' # 胜利数据卡片背景色 loseCardColor = '#28d3190c' # 失败数据卡片背景色 careerGamesNumber = 20 # 生涯界面显示对局数量 uiTheme = 'dark' # 界面主题(dark/light)

位置特定策略配置

Seraphine支持为不同游戏位置配置独立的BP策略,提升战术针对性:

上单位置策略:重点禁用当前版本强势对线英雄,优先选择counter pick英雄

打野位置策略:关注敌方打野英雄池,禁用前期入侵能力强的英雄

中单位置策略:针对版本强势法师和刺客,配置相应的禁用优先级

下路双人组策略:ADC关注保护型辅助克制关系,辅助关注开团型英雄禁用

数据更新与维护机制

自动更新系统:Seraphine内置自动更新机制,定期检查以下数据源:

  • 英雄数据:从官方API获取最新英雄信息和技能数据
  • OPGG数据:每小时自动更新英雄胜率、出场率、禁用率
  • 版本兼容:适配英雄联盟客户端版本更新,确保功能稳定性
  • Bug修复:及时修复已知问题和兼容性问题


Seraphine中的段位信息展示与数据分析


🔧 技术实现原理

LCU API通信机制

Seraphine通过英雄联盟客户端开放的LCU(League Client Update)API实现数据交互,这是Riot Games官方提供的客户端通信接口:

WebSocket连接建立:工具启动时自动检测客户端运行状态,通过本地WebSocket建立双向通信通道

API请求封装:将复杂的API调用封装为简洁的函数接口,开发者可通过app/lol/connector.py模块调用所有客户端功能

事件驱动架构:基于游戏状态变化(如进入匹配、BP开始、游戏加载)自动触发相应操作

数据安全与隐私保护

本地数据处理原则:所有游戏数据的采集、分析和展示均在用户本地设备完成,不涉及云端数据传输

API合规使用:严格遵循Riot Games API使用条款,仅访问公开可用的游戏数据接口

无文件修改:Seraphine不修改任何游戏文件或内存数据,完全通过官方接口实现功能


🎮 实战应用场景

排位赛进阶辅助

在排位赛环境中,Seraphine提供全方位的战术支持:

预选阶段情报收集:在BP开始前自动查询队友的排位历史、常用位置、英雄池深度,为团队沟通提供数据支持

对手针对性分析:根据敌方队伍的英雄选择历史,推荐相应的counter pick和禁用策略

数据驱动的BP决策:结合版本胜率数据和个人英雄熟练度,提供最优的英雄选择建议

大乱斗模式优化

ARAM模式下,Seraphine提供专属的功能优化:

英雄Buff信息实时显示:在英雄选择界面直接显示每个英雄的伤害加成/减免百分比

大乱斗专属符文配置:提供适合ARAM模式的符文预设,一键应用到游戏客户端

娱乐模式数据参考:基于大乱斗特定数据源,提供英雄在该模式下的强度评级


Seraphine在召唤师峡谷模式中的胜利数据分析


❓ 常见问题解答

Q:使用Seraphine是否违反游戏规则?

A:Seraphine完全基于Riot Games官方提供的LCU API开发,不修改游戏文件、不注入代码、不读取游戏内存,从技术原理上符合官方API使用条款。但任何第三方工具的使用都存在一定风险,建议用户自行评估。

Q:为什么某些功能无法正常使用?

A:请按以下步骤排查:

  1. 确认英雄联盟客户端正在运行且版本为最新
  2. 检查Seraphine与客户端的连接状态(界面应有连接成功提示)
  3. 在设置界面确认相关功能已启用
  4. 如问题持续,尝试重启Seraphine和英雄联盟客户端

Q:数据更新延迟如何处理?

A:战绩数据延迟通常由英雄联盟服务器响应时间导致,OPGG数据每小时自动更新一次。如遇数据不准确,可手动触发数据刷新功能。

Q:是否支持Mac或Linux系统?

A:目前仅支持Windows系统,因为英雄联盟LCU API主要面向Windows客户端实现。Linux用户可通过Wine等兼容层尝试运行,但功能完整性无法保证。

Q:如何反馈Bug或功能建议?

A:可通过项目的Issue页面提交详细的问题描述或功能建议,包括操作步骤、预期结果、实际结果、系统环境等信息。


📊 性能优化与最佳实践

资源占用优化

Seraphine在设计时充分考虑了性能影响:

内存占用控制:运行时内存占用约50-100MB,对系统资源影响极小

CPU使用优化:采用事件驱动架构,仅在需要时执行数据处理,空闲时资源占用接近零

网络请求优化:合并重复API调用,缓存常用数据,减少不必要的网络通信

使用最佳实践建议

为获得最佳使用体验,建议遵循以下实践:

  1. 网络环境:确保稳定的网络连接,避免因网络问题导致数据获取失败
  2. 客户端版本:保持英雄联盟客户端为最新版本,避免API兼容性问题
  3. 工具更新:定期更新Seraphine到最新版本,获取新功能和Bug修复
  4. 功能选择性启用:根据实际需求启用相关功能,避免不必要的资源消耗

🎯 总结与行动号召

Seraphine作为一款专业的英雄联盟智能辅助工具,通过自动化数据采集和智能分析,为玩家提供了全面的信息优势和决策支持。无论是排位冲分还是娱乐对局,都能显著提升游戏体验和竞技效率。

核心价值总结

  • 信息优势:自动化战绩查询和数据分析
  • 决策支持:智能BP建议和英雄选择推荐
  • 效率提升:自动化重复操作,专注游戏本身
  • 安全合规:基于官方API开发,不修改游戏文件

立即开始使用

  • 下载预编译版本快速体验
  • 或通过源码运行进行深度定制
  • 根据个人游戏习惯调整配置参数
  • 加入社区讨论获取使用技巧

通过Seraphine的智能辅助,将繁琐的数据查询和操作自动化,让你能够更专注于游戏策略和操作技巧,在英雄联盟的竞技世界中获得真正的竞争优势。

【免费下载链接】Seraphine英雄联盟战绩查询工具项目地址: https://gitcode.com/gh_mirrors/se/Seraphine

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.cnnetsun.cn/news/2668556.html

相关文章:

  • 别只导出APK了!用Unity 2022构建Android App Bundle (AAB),为上架Google Play Store做准备
  • 解决Keil MCBSTR750评估板Flash下载超时问题
  • 避坑指南:Silvaco TCAD 2018安装后TonyPlot报错?手把手教你配置与版本切换
  • Arm架构中的消息处理单元(MHU)原理与应用
  • 别再只用默认参数了!用UE5 Niagara系统手把手教你调出电影级火焰特效(附材质球避坑指南)
  • 代码实践技巧
  • 电赛A题单相逆变器:除了F280049C,这些主控和拓扑方案你考虑过吗?
  • 一行代码实现智能停车:物联网传感器与数据融合实战解析
  • 【Redis】持久化机制
  • 单片机时钟电路设计全解析
  • 从Google Duplex看对话式AI:技术原理、伦理挑战与工程实践
  • AR眼镜设计实战:如何将Lumerical光栅模型导入Ansys Speos进行系统级杂散光分析
  • 从三调到日常:一个ArcGIS Pro面积平差工具包的迭代与封装思路
  • 告别硬边UI!用UE4材质和UMG轻松实现CSS级圆角按钮(附完整材质蓝图)
  • 华为云Stack网络排障实战:从OVS流表看懂VXLAN流量转发(附抓包分析)
  • 终极窗口分辨率控制指南:如何用SRWE突破游戏窗口限制
  • Flutter UI2CODE:从Figma设计稿到可运行代码的自动化实践
  • dSPACE安装避坑大全:从系统准备到MicroAutoBox II注册,我踩过的雷你别再踩
  • Unity3D项目突然报WakeUp为空?别慌,试试这个重启大法(附详细步骤)
  • AI助手最后一公里:从技术能力到实用价值的跨越策略
  • C++lambda表达式与函数式编程
  • 别再折腾了!Ubuntu 22.04下CLion 2022.2.5保姆级安装与性能调优全攻略
  • 别再傻傻分不清!DDR4/5与LPDDR4/5的ECC方案到底有啥不同?
  • 团队协作必备:如何为你的Aurix TriCore项目搭建稳定的Tasking浮动许可证环境
  • CSS渐变背景从入门到‘会玩’:linear-gradient和radial-gradient的10个隐藏技巧与常见坑点
  • PIM架构:突破内存墙的计算革命与优化实践
  • 别再只调学习率了!深入浅出图解目标检测四大IOU Loss的演进与坑点
  • 别再只用TileMap了!用Godot4.2手搓一个轻量级2D网格节点(附完整源码)
  • Unity VR开发避坑:用XR Interaction Toolkit 2.3.2搞定角色移动与楼梯碰撞(附自定义CharacterController脚本)
  • Lindy自动化部署全链路解析:从零配置到生产级合约监控的7个关键节点